Abstract: This course learning about the history of the women’s movement in the U.S. as well as about contemporary women’s issues. Issues that we will discuss include feminism, gender roles and socialization, sexuality, masculinity, marriage and the family, birth and mothering, women and work, race and feminism, violence against women, reproductive health and rights, women and the law, and global feminism. The course will also incorporate video material that illustrate and illuminate some of these issues.
